One of the recent discoveries in the field of cosmology are stars called pulsar which is a condensed form of the word pulsating-star.


Pulsar are highly magnetized, rotating neutron stars that emit a beam of electromagnetic radiation. The radiation can only be observed when the beam of emission is pointing towards the Earth. This is called the lighthouse effect and gives rise to the pulsed nature that gives pulsars their name. Because neutron stars are very dense objects, the rotation period and thus the interval between observed pulses is very regular. For some pulsars, the regularity of pulsation is as precise as an atomic clock.

Neutron Stars form from the stellar core that remains after stars have exploded as supernovae . If the remaining core is between One and Half to Three Solar Masses then it contracts to form a Neutron Star . Neutron Stars are typically only about 10 km. in diameter and consist entirely of Sub-Atomic Particles (Neutrons) .

They rotate rapidly and emit two beams of Radio Waves , which sweep across the sky and are detected as short Pulses.The matter of a Pulsar (Neutron Star) is so dense that it can literally pierce through anything it collides with. It sends pulses of bright electromagnetic radiation.

A neutron star is so dense that one teaspoon (5 milliliters) of its material would have a mass over 5.5×10^12 kg, about 900 times the mass of the Great Pyramid of Giza. The resulting force of gravity is so strong that if an object were to fall from a height of one meter it would only take one microsecond to hit the surface of the neutron star, and would do so at around 2000 kilometers per second, or 7.2 million kilometers per hour.
